XMedia Recode 3.0.2.5
A guide to uninstall XMedia Recode 3.0.2.5 from your system
You can find on this page detailed information on how to uninstall XMedia Recode 3.0.2.5 for Windows. It is developed by
Sebastian Dfler. Open
here for more info on Sebastian Dfler. More data about the application XMedia Recode 3.0.2.5 can be seen at
http://www.xmedia-recode.de. The program is often located in the C:\Program Files\XMedia Recode directory. Take into account that this path can differ depending on the user's decision. XMedia Recode 3.0.2.5's full uninstall command line is C:\Program Files\XMedia Recode\uninst.exe. XMedia Recode 3.0.2.5's primary file takes about 2.90 MB (3037184 bytes) and is named XMedia Recode.exe.
The following executables are installed alongside XMedia Recode 3.0.2.5. They take about 2.97 MB (
3110535 bytes) on disk.
- uninst.exe (71.63 KB)
- XMedia Recode.exe (2.90 MB)
The information on this page is only about version
3.0.2.5 of XMedia Recode 3.0.2.5.
